Please see below a communication we have received from Vodafone with regards to the handling of Premium SMS traffic from 13th January 2018.

Vodafone has now had time to consider the implementation of the Payment Service Directive (PSD2) which going forward needs to be known as Payment Services Regulation 2017 which is coming into effect on 13.1.2018 and as the legislation has passed across with no mitigation for the Electronic Communications Networks (ECNs) in the scope of the number ranges captured (scope remains 09x 118x 0871/2, VSC, PSMS and CTB. Bulk SMS and Bulk MMS are out of scope) therefore it is vital that Vodafone and partners take action to remain in compliance with this legislation.

As you will be aware the transposition/implementation document from HM Treasury is that the exclusion from FCA PSR regulation cascades down along the value chain. This simplifies many things but the introduction of new transaction limits means that the phone-paid services element of Vodafone needs to adapt to the £40 per transaction limit and the cumulative £240 a month spend limit. The FCA has confirmed separately that the Network Access Charge is NOT part of these limits and so the only element of interest in voice calls is the Service Charge (inc VAT) portion of the cost to the consumer.

Therefore, this is official notice that there are important requirements that will need to be acknowledged and actioned by you as our partners in order to comply with the spend caps imposed by the PSR 2017.

1. All captured voice calls must be terminated before the customer reaches the £40 transaction limit based on service charges only. Please note that if there is existing OfCom/PSA regulation regarding number ranges (adult etc) at a lower level, these lower limits remain the requirement.

2. All PSMS services will need to be diverted into Charge to Bill transactions (in the same way that Charity Donations are today) using the ER platform. This is so that the existing transaction, daily and monthly spend limits can be used to regulate the customers PSMS expenditure. Vodafone will send out a detailed guide to these requirements.

What does this mean for Fonix customers

1. We will be transitioning all PSMS billing over to charge to bill on the Vodafone network
2. All Shortcodes will be submitted to Vodafone by Fonix to implement the change
3. The change will take place on an agreed date and time with codes being switched over in stages to minimise the impact to clients
4. The change will be staggered from 7th December and your account manager will contact you to discuss the process
5. Fonix will create logic to support the switch to charge to bill so there is no requirement for customers to integrate into a separate API
6. Vodafone has confirmed there is no current plans to change the commercial terms
